Etki alanındayken Windows 7'de Otomatik Oturum Açma'yı nasıl etkinleştiririm?


81

Windows 7 bir etki alanına katıldığında, otomatik olarak oturum açma seçeneği gelişmiş Kullanıcı Yönetimi konsolunda artık kullanılamaz. SharePoint ve TFS nedeniyle küçük bir ev etki alanı çalıştırdığımdan, bu ayarı nasıl etkinleştirebilirim?

Buradaki HowToGeek Makalesi , bir etki alanına katıldığında seçenekler devre dışı bırakılsa da onu kapsar.

Yanıtlar:


115

Gönderen: Dijital Hayatım Makalesi

  1. Başlat'ı tıklatın, Çalıştır'ı tıklatın, yazın regeditve sonra Tamam'ı tıklatın. Windows Vista / 7'de, regeditAramaya Başla yazın ve Enter tuşuna basın.

  2. Aşağıdaki kayıt defteri anahtarına gidin:

    H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on

  3. DefaultUserNameGirişi çift ​​tıklatın, oturum açmak için kullanıcı adını yazın ve ardından Tamam'ı tıklatın.

    Eğer DefaultUserNamekayıt defteri değeri adı bulunmazsa, yeni oluşturmak Dize değeri (REG_SZ) olarak değer adıyla DefaultUserName.

  4. DefaultPasswordGirdiyi çift ​​tıklayın, değer verisi kutusunun altındaki kullanıcı hesabı için şifreyi yazın ve ardından Tamam'ı tıklayın.

    Değer yoksa, değer adıyla birlikte DefaultPasswordyeni bir Dize Değeri (REG_SZ) oluşturun DefaultPassword.

    Hiçbir eğer unutmayın DefaultPassworddizesi belirtilmemişse, Windows otomatik değerini değiştirir AutoAdminLogonkapatmak için 0 (yanlış) 1 (doğru) olan kayıt defteri anahtarı AutoAdminLogonözelliğini.

  5. Windows Vista / 7'de DefaultDomainNamede belirtilmesi gerekir, aksi halde Windows, kullanıcı adı olarak görüntülenen geçersiz kullanıcı adı ister .\username. Bunu yapmak için, üzerine çift tıklayın DefaultDomainNameve kullanıcı hesabının alan adını belirtin. Yerel kullanıcı ise, yerel ana bilgisayar adını belirtin.

    Eğer DefaultDomainNameyoksa, yeni bir oluşturmak Dize Değeri (REG_SZ) olarak değer adıyla kayıt anahtarını DefaultDomainName.

  6. AutoAdminLogonGirişi çift ​​tıklatın, 1Değer Verisi kutusuna yazın ve sonra Tamam'ı tıklatın.

    Giriş yoksa , değer adıyla AutoAdminLogonyeni bir Dize Değeri (REG_SZ) oluşturun AutoAdminLogon.

  7. Varsa, AutoLogonCountanahtarı silin .

  8. Ayrıca varsa, AutoLogonCheckedanahtarı silin .

  9. Kayıt Defteri Düzenleyicisi'nden çıkın.

  10. Sırasıyla Başlat'ı, Yeniden Başlat'ı ve sonra Tamam'ı tıklatın.


1
Bunun, etki alanına katılan bir Windows 7 VM ile çalıştığını onaylayabilirim. Kayıt defterindeki parolanın ne kadar erişilebilir olduğu konusunda endişelerim var: bu anahtarları okumak için hiçbir ayrıcalık gerekmez; ancak VM benim tarafımdan kullanıldı, umarım çok ciddi değildir.
jmtd

@jmtd - çalışmak ve en iyi güvenlik uygulamaları iki ayrı şeydir! Ben sadece bir kiosk / misafir / benzer bir hesap için bunu tavsiye ederim.
William Hilsum

2
Bir kioskta, kullanıcıların oturum açma şifresine erişmelerini önlemek için kayıt defteri erişimini devre dışı bırakmak için Grup İlkesi kullanmanız gerekir. Ayar User Config\Admin Templates\System\Prevent Access to Registry Editing Tools.
Bacon,

2
Muhtemelen bunu yapmanın en akıllı yolu değildir. Kayıt defterinde regedit.exe kullanmadan almak için birden çok yolu vardır. VBScript, PowerShell, "reg" komutu ve muhtemelen daha fazlası. Kullanıcıların görüntülemesini önlemek için ACL'yi kayıt defteri anahtarının kendisinde değiştirmek daha iyi bir fikirdir.
Tmdean

1
... Yaptığım küçük yorumu eklemek için, eğer bunu bir kiosk veya benzeri için kullanıyorsanız, kullanıcıların kiosk modunda kilitli bir yazılımı / tarayıcıyı kullanıyor olacağınızı, böylece kullanıcıların masaüstüne erişemeyeceğini umarsınız .. .
William Hilsum

21

William Hilsum'un cevabına ek olarak, bu yöntem şifrenizi kayıt defterinde düz metin olarak bırakmanızı gerektirmez (kimlik doğrulamanın gerçekte nasıl saklandığından emin değilim).

Aşama 1

Yerel bir yönetici olarak, Windows'a yöneticilerin otomatik olarak oturum açmasına izin vermesini söyleyin.

Regedit'te, adresine göz atın H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on. Orada değilse, AutoAdminLogon Bu değeri 1 olarak ayarla adlı yeni bir Dize Değeri oluşturun.

Adım 2

Windows’a giriş yapmak için şifreyi hatırlamasını söyle.

Çalıştır kutusuna control userpasswords2 etki alanı kullanıcı adınızın listede olduğundan emin olun, değilse ekleyin. Untick (veya tick ve unick): Kullanıcılar bu bilgisayarı kullanmak için bir kullanıcı adı ve şifre girmelidir. Kullanıcı adınızın seçildiğinden emin olun. Uygula'yı tıklayın.

Bu noktada, Windows kullanılacak olan şifreyi sormalıdır.

Aşama 3

Şimdi geri dönerek H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on aşağıdaki Dize Değerlerinin ayarlandığından emin olun;

  • DefaultUserName: Etki alanı kullanıcı adınız (etki alanı öneki olmadan)
  • DefaultDomainName: Etki alanınız

Bu olmalı.

Şifre değişiklikleriyle ilgili not:

Şifrenizi her değiştirdiğinizde 2. adımdan itibaren bu işlemi tekrar etmeniz gerekecektir. Ne yazık ki Windows, bu diyalogu her kaydettiğinizde DefaultDomainName öğesini yerel makine adınıza sıfırlar;


"Userpasswords2" kontrol paneli uygulamasından kurtulan Windows 7 SP1 olmalı. Artık var görünmüyor.
Josh M.

1
SP1'de benim için çalışıyor. Belirtildiği gibi Çalıştır kutusundan çalıştırdınız mı? Kontrol panelinde listelenmiyor - el ile çalıştırmanız gerekiyor.
Adam Millerchip

Bir etki alanında olduğum ve bu durumda kontrol paneli uygulamasının bulunmadığı olabilir. Neden olduğundan emin değilim, ama gelmedi. control userpasswords22003'ten beri kullanıyorum . ;-)
Josh M.

2
Sadece bir düşünce vardı. OP'nin bağlantısına göre, siz de denediniz netplwizmi?
Adam Millerchip

2
Parola düz metin içerisinde saklanmadığı için bu cevabı tercih ediyorum. Win7 SP1'de bir etki alanı ortamında benim için çalıştı.
jmagnusson

3

@Adam Millerchip'in cevabına ek olarak, yeni şifreyi saklamak için her zaman tekrar kontrol userpasswords2'yi çalıştırmak zorunda kaldığımızda, bir etki alanına katılmadan önce şifre değiştirme çabasını bir etki alanına katılmadan önce azaltabiliriz. Artık bir etki alanındayız, bunun yerine yalnızca userpasswords2 denetimi çalıştıran ve aynı zamanda etki alanı ve kullanıcı adı kayıt defteri ayarlarımızı geri yükleyen bir toplu iş dosyası çalıştırabiliriz:

AfterPwdChange.bat

control userpasswords2
pause
regedit /s WinLogonBit.reg

WinLogonBit.reg

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on]
"DefaultUserName"="mydomainusername"
"DefaultDomainName"="mydomain"

Ve otomatik oturum açma isteğinin nedeni, başlangıç ​​programlarının çalışmasını sağlamaksa, açılıştan sonra iş istasyonunun kilitlenmesini yine de tercih edebiliriz. Öyleyse, aşağıdaki komutu içeren Başlangıç ​​klasörüne bir kısayol yerleştirebiliriz:

C:\Windows\System32\rundll32.exe user32.dll,LockWorkStation

-1

Belki bunu bir yarasa dosyası olarak çalıştırabilirsin:

REG ADD "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/v DefaultUserName /t REG_SZ /d YourUserNameHere /f
REG ADD "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/v DefaultPassword /t REG_SZ /d YourPasswordHere /f
REG ADD "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/v DefaultDomainName /t REG_SZ /d YourDomainHere /f
REG ADD "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/v AutoAdminLogon /t REG_SZ /d 1 /f

REG DELETE "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/v AutoLogonCount /f
REG DELETE "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on" /v AutoLogonChecked /f

1
Bu komut ne yapar? Lütfen açıklayın ve oyumu kaldıracağım.
juniorRubyist,

SuperUser'a Hoşgeldiniz! 9 yıl önce cevaplanmış bir soruya gönderiyorsunuz ve oylarla bu cevabı çok yardımcı oldu gibi görünüyor. Cevabınız bunun ne olduğunu daha fazla açıklamadan buna bir şey ekleyip eklemeyeceğinden emin değilim. Stack Overflow turuna katılmak için bir dakikanızı ayırırsanız daha iyi bir deneyim yaşayacağınızı göreceksiniz . Yığın Taşması topluluğunun normlarını izler ve başkalarına yardım etme tutumuyla yaklaşırsanız, size iyi hizmet edecektir.
Rey Juna,
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.